Understanding On-Grid Solar Panel Systems

On-grid PV system setups offer a popular method for producing electricity using sunlight. These units are engineered to interface directly to the power grid, permitting you to feed excess power back to the provider and possibly earn credits on your account. Unlike off-grid solutions, on-grid systems need a link to the public power network. Here’s a quick look:

  • Grid Interconnection: Directly links to the utility infrastructure.
  • Net Metering: Allows sending excess electricity back to the grid.
  • No Batteries: Usually doesn't contain storage support.
  • Reliability: Depends on the stability of the utility grid.

Perks of a On-Grid Solar System for Your Dwelling

A on-grid solar setup offers significant perks for property owners. Primarily, you can continue to receive electricity from the utility grid when your solar panels aren't producing enough electricity , ensuring a reliable energy source . Furthermore, any excess energy your installation produces and doesn't utilize can be sent back to the power lines, often leading to credits on your monthly electric invoice. This may dramatically decrease your total energy costs , making solar a economically wise choice.
